さつがい
noun / suru verb
killing, murder
1. killing, murder, slaying
The act of killing a person. A formal and objective term used in news reports, legal contexts, and historical accounts, without the specific legal connotation of 'homicide' that 殺人 carries.
容疑者(ようぎしゃ)殺害(さつがい)(みと)めた。
The suspect admitted to the killing.
被害者(ひがいしゃ)自宅(じたく)殺害(さつがい)されたとみられる。
The victim is believed to have been killed at home.
事件(じけん)背景(はいけい)には、金銭(きんせん)をめぐるトラブルがあり、計画的(けいかくてき)殺害(さつがい)されたと警察(けいさつ)()ている。
Police believe the victim was killed in a premeditated act, with a financial dispute behind the incident.

USAGE:
A formal term used in news reporting and legal contexts. Functions as both a noun and a suru verb (殺害(さつがい)する = to kill). The passive form 殺害(さつがい)される (to be killed) is extremely common in news reports.

SIMILAR WORDS:
殺人(さつじん) is a legal/criminal term meaning 'murder' or 'homicide' (the crime itself). 殺害(さつがい) describes the act of killing more broadly and objectively.

COMMON COLLOCATIONS:

  • 殺害(さつがい)される: to be killed
  • 殺害(さつがい)事件(じけん): murder case
  • 殺害(さつがい)(みと)める: to admit to killing
  • 計画的(けいかくてき)殺害(さつがい): premeditated killing
